The Provident Projects

So for the last few weeks I have had several projects that have been very light on the budget. Free actually. It has been fun to experiment and reuse old things to make something new.

A t-shirt at J.Crew inspired my first project. I cut some flower shapes out of an old tank top, and tacked a bunch of different sizes together.


I have been adding them to a variety of items. You can probably follow my flower trail. I may have gone a bit overboard.



This flower headband was made out of an old suede purse that I haven't used in years. I think I will get much more mileage out of this pretty little hair piece.


My friend and I found these kid-sized chairs in the alley next to the dumpster. Jon has started to sand the gunk away (they were seriously gross)!
I plan on painting one lime, one orange, one magenta, and one navy.


A quick baby gift after sewing some scraps of cute material onto some burp cloths that I never used for Edyn.


And, after reviewing my summer wardrobe, I went through my closet and found a few pair of old pants that I rarely wear and turned them into summer skirts, just like my mom used to do for me when I was younger. Such an easy project that I can hang at the park in.
